Ingredients For crust
17 gingersnap cookies (I used Trader Joes)
Ingredients For Filling
1 – 8 oz. package of full fat cream cheese, room temperature
1/3 C granulated white sugar
1/8 tsp. salt
1 large egg, room temperature
½ tsp. pure vanilla extract
¼ C full fat sour cream, room temperature
¼ C vanilla yogurt
Ingredients For Strawberries
2 cups strawberries, sliced
1/2 cup Wild Turkey honey bourbon
Directions For Crust
Line muffin pans with foil liners and place a cookie in the bottom of each one.
Directions For Filling
Preheat oven to 300 degrees.
With a hand mixer beat cream cheese on low speed until creamy and smooth. It’s important to use low so you do not add too much air into the mixing process, which could cause cracking on the top of the cake. Add sugar and salt. Beat to combine. Keep sides of bowl scraped down. Add egg, beating until incorporated. Add remaining ingredients and beat just until blended. Overmixing can also cause cracking.
Distribute batter evenly among all muffin cups. Bake for approximately 20 minutes, until set. The top should look a little wet and the center a little wobbly. Resist the urge to leave them beyond this time. Over baking can create cracking too.
If you’ve never baked cheesecake before it can be difficult to tell when they’re done. This is made more complicated because you can’t taste test or poke them as cheesecakes must rest in the refrigerator to develop their optimum texture.
Remove cheesecakes from the oven and allow them to cool completely on a wire rack. Refrigerate for at least several hours, ideally overnight.
Directions For Strawberry Topping
Place berries in a bowl and pour bourbon over them at least 2 hours before serving cheesecake.
